Cost-Effectiveness in Health and Medicine by Marthe R Gold
This is a discussion of the uses and conduct of the cost-effectiveness analyses (CEA) as decision-making aids in the health and medical fields. It presents the most explicit recommendations to date in the field of CEA in order to improve the policy relevance of these studies.
